    Re: When did Louisville first make MAPLE bats fothe pros

    Techincally, Louisville Slugger made some Maple bats back in the 30's not many because of the drying procedures back then coudln't produce light enough timber and the machinery they used wasn't the best for turning Maple.
    Yes, Joe Carter was the first when Maple came back. They started turning Maple in 1997-1998. No major production started until 2002, now it's half of our production.

    SAM only makes Maple.
